Deconstructing The Magician

(The Critically Aclaimed One-Man-Show)
60 to 90min. One-Man-Show
This show began in the fall of 2001 as a response to all of those FOX "Magic Secrets Revealed" television specials. What I wanted to create is two-fold: one – a show that didn't expose magic per se but instead, exposed the magician and two – a non-magic show, where the magic was used to further the story not just create spectacle.

The end result is an extraordinary theatrical experience that uses video, music, and sophisticated stage magic to probe the intricate web of lessons, choices and experiences that has shaped and defined one man's life.

In the fun-filled hour of this solo performance you'll witness a classic street hustle, a demonstration of precognitive abilities, a Houdini challenge of a different kind and a re-interpreted re-creation of a classic illusion known as “The Sawing”.

All of which is presented in a rich and generous dialog that explores the questions of “what is real and what is illusion”. When it's over, you may discover that it's not so important how it's done, but why it's done in the first place.

Directed by: Thomas Cote
